FAIRFAX—Dr Craig R Dufresne, MD, FACS, FISCFS, was named Senior Editor of, AppLAg: The Journal of Appalachian Local and Agricultural History, a peer reviewed, open access scholarly journal officially launched today and published by Moss Hill Farm LLC. Dufresne has previously held editorial duties, including as Section Editor at the journal, Aesthetic Plastic Surgery.
A world-renowned DC area rare disease specialist and cosmetic and reconstructive plastic surgeon, Dufresne holds an agricultural degree, is an avid horticulturist, has experience in historical research, and has family roots in farming. In recent years, Dufresne also has been working in the area of Appalachian farming and local history, with his work resulting in two conference presentations (https://cdufresnemd.com/wp-content/uploads/2024/03/Moss-Farm_Poling_Handouts-ASA-Meeting-24.pdf and https://cdufresnemd.com/wp-content/uploads/2024/05/Moss-Farm_Poling_Handouts-SAH-Meeting-24.pdf) and a preprint, to date.
The journal, AppLAg, seeks to serve as a nexus between the academic community and the common man living, working, and farming in Appalachia. By fulfilling this mission, the Journal seeks to contribute meaningfully to preserving the local and agricultural history and heritage of Appalachia. The Journal’s vision is to be the premier forum for cutting-edge rigorous research and thought-provoking insights in local and agricultural history within Appalachia. The Journal is seeking submissions of original research; reviews of the secondary literature; historically important photographs, stories, traditions, and transcribed interviews; poems and short stories, and book reviews. The Journal is also inviting peer reviewers.
Moss Hill Farm LLC is a historic multi-generational Appalachian family farm that traces its origin to the Shenandoah Valley. The Farm is dedicated to historic preservation and hopes to encourage increased rigorous scholarly interest in local history and farming history within Appalachia.
